The desorption solution - an alternative approach to measure water soluble ions in soils.

TL;DR: In this paper, an alternative procedure to obtain the soil solution and determine all relevant anions and cations is presented, in which the soil samples are taken with an auger and 10-20 g of field moist soil are desorbed in a pressure chamber at 170 kPa (pF 3.2), with a cellulose acetate membrane filter (∅ < 0.45 μm) as capillar bridge between the interior and exterior of the chamber.
